Celtic FC could get their hands on former Arsenal midfielder Jack Wilshere if the SPFL side name Eddie Howe as their next manager.

Recent reports are claiming that Eddie Howe is currently the favourite to be named as the next Celtic FC manager and according to ex-Premier League goalkeeper Paddy Kenny, Jack Wilshere could be tempted to join the Scottish giants if Howe is appointed as their next boss.

“I think he could be tempted,” Kenny told Football Insider. “He’s got connections with Howe, so why not? He’s on a free after all. It would be a good signing for everyone, I think.

“It does depend whether Wilshere would want to move up to Scotland because it’s not like an hour’s drive away.

“It’s a massive club, Celtic. They need to turn things around next season because they’ve had a disappointing year.

“But listen, players like that aren’t out of contract often. If Eddie Howe does get the job, I think this is something they could definitely look at. It would be a great deal.

“He’s had a history of injuries so it would be nice for him to win some trophies.”

Jack Wilshere was set to become the next best thing in the Premier League when he was coming up through the ranks at Arsenal. But a series of injuries have since halted his progress and right now, he is playing for Bournemouth in the Championship.

Normally any other ex-PL star will not be too inclined to join an SPFL side at the age of 29 but Jack Wilshere was without a club for the first half of the season before joining Bournemouth in January. So he should ideally take this opportunity with open arms.

His time at Bournemouth has not been particularly great either having scored just one and assisting another goal in 14 Championship matches and with his contract ending later this month, a move to Celtic could be a really nice option for him.

This transfer obviously will depend on the fact if Celtic do decide to bring in Eddie Howe as their next boss.
